2015 was very productive year

Ups include:


–SKIN DEEP MAGIC was on a couple of college syllabi, and I got to do two author visits with college students, and it was a finalist for the Lambda Literary Award.

–BEREFT, my YA novel about bullying, racism and homophobia, won a Bronze Moonbeam and a Silver IPPY Award


–I got to assist with editors choosing the fiction in QUEERS DESTROY HORROR.

–I got to go to WORLD HORROR in Atlanta, which led to several professional friendships.

–My novelette THE NECTAR OF NIGHTMARES was published and illustrated got good reviews

–My first collection, SEA, SWALLOW ME & OTHER STORIES was turned into an audiobook.

All are bucket list accomplishments.


Downs include:

The death of Tanith Lee. We used to exchange emails and she was very supportive of all of my work. I only met her once. We had planned a visit before her illness. I dedicated THE NECTAR OF NIGHTMARES to her.
